Marchionne 'expects' Ferrari victories in 2016 starting in Spain
Ferrari president Sergio Marchionne expects the Italian marque will start to turn the tables on its rival Mercedes, starting with victory at this weekend's Spanish Grand Prix. Ferrari currently sit second in the championship standings, albeit 81 points adrift of Mercedes, but the team have struggled to match the Brackley-based outfit on pure pace, with Nico Rosberg dominating all but the Australian Grand Prix which Sebastian Vettel had led up until a strategy error cost him a potential victory.
